Re: Official Thread Of Free To Air Satellite Tv (part 5 - The Final Part) by Ameboperoo(m): 12:02pm On May 16, 2011 |
Ellahdarrell:@ Ellahdarell. 2M is on Eutelsat W6 at 21.6°E. It is on ku band with this frequency 11669V2480. U need @ least 90cm dish to track it. |
